Responsibilities
- Assists patients with daily activities as delegated by the rehabilitation team.
- Communicates patient concerns and changes in condition to rehabilitation nurses or therapists.
- Documents appropriate patient information in their medical records.
- Obtains vital signs and records in the electronic medical record.
- Performs special procedures including the collection of urine, stool, and sputum.
- Reviews treatments/ADLs/hygiene with patients and families.
- Aids patients with feeding and attends Therapeutic Dining Group as indicated.
- Aids patients with body mechanics.
- Helps maintain clean and healthy environment for the patient.
- Aids with equipment care.
Requirements
- BLS (CPR) required or must be obtained within 30 days of hire within this role.
- Part-time or full-time active student status.
- Successful completion of the first term of nursing courses of a professional Registered Nurse or Licensed Practical/Vocational Nurse program.
- Must be currently enrolled and in good academic standing in a professional Registered Nurse or Licensed Practical/Vocational Nurse program.
- Initial term including didactic/skills lab must include fundamentals of nursing or course equivalent.
- Success in returning one or two (if available) instructor evaluations indicating satisfactory performance of fundamental nursing skills.
- Completion of preceptor tool and core competency at 90 days and annually.
- Presentation of proof of continued enrollment and passing grade in nursing classes each semester until graduation and remain in good academic standing.
- One year experience in inpatient clinical setting preferred.
